Optimasi Pemanfaatan Air Embung Kasih untuk Domestik dan Irigasi Tetes Ginting, Segel; Rahmandani, Dadan; Indarta, Abid Hendri

Abstract

The Government of Indonesian was built Embung Kasih (retention basin) to overcome limited water resources in Tuatuka Village, NTT Province. It was planned for irrigation and domestic use. Retention basin operations require detailed planning with limited storage, so the water utilization optimizes are necessaries. These are needed to determine water use with several scenarios of rainfall conditions. It was conducted by the Generalized Reduced Gradient Method to maximize water use as an objective function. Water utilizes simulation in 1974 to 2015 was conducted as an evaluation of the reliability assessment. The objective of this research determines water used optimally for domestic use and irrigation. The results are obtained by several scenarios. The first scenario related to normal rainfall conditions, water use for domestic is around 2,604 people or irrigating 2.746 ha area using drip irrigation. The second scenario for extreme wet rainfall conditions, water use for domestic is around 3,601 people or land irrigating around 4.698 ha area. The third scenario with extreme dry rainfall conditions can produce water use for domestic is around 454 people or land irrigating around 0.45 ha area. Following their results by using the simulation method with data from 1974 to 2015, water use for domestic is, determined to be around 454 people, and an area irrigated 1 Ha with operational reliability assessment reaching 78.57%.
